THE PROJECT
In the future, we want to make travel more holistic and enrich it with a solidarity aspect. That means: vacation + a pinch of “travel realism” + a good deed. To achieve this, we are guided by the UN’s Sustainable Development Goals, in particular SDG 10, combating social inequality in the world. In order to implement our idea in Salzburg, we developed three social vacation activities for Salzburg through an intensive creative process with around 140 participants.
Social Sight
Find out more about Salzburg’s less glamorous side on an interactive postcard wall. Donate on site if you like the idea.
Admire the outdoor artwork Beyond the Postcard on the grounds of Hohensalzburg Fortress. Look behind the facades of the city and learn more about the lives of many people in Salzburg.
If you can, donate €1 to a local social organization that helps Salzburg residents in need.
Where? Hohensalzburg Fortress, passageway at the Marionette Theater
+1€ Ticket & Hotel
Volunteer to support people who are less fortunate at your vacation destination with a small financial contribution.
Are you booking a hotel room in Salzburg or buying a museum ticket?
Voluntarily decide to pay €1 more when paying. It will go directly to a local social institution as your donation.

Supported associations
Beyond the Postcard is designed as a two-year pilot project. During this period, tourists can leave a small amount of money as a “guest gift” directly at Salzburg’s first social attraction on Hohensalzburg Fortress. This donation goes directly, without deductions and alternates, every six months to local social associations. The larger and smaller associations support important, committed projects, all of which benefit Salzburg residents in need.
CARITAS Salzburg
As a large, Europe-wide known organization, CARITAS Salzburg is the first partner of Beyond the Postcard. The partnership will initially run for six months. All donations received up to that point will go exclusively to selected local Caritas projects in areas such as housing, health, education, culture and social contacts.
